Key Features of 2026 Kid Drones
- Noise Reduction Technology: Specially designed propellers and sound dampening materials significantly reduce operational noise.
- Safety Features: Built-in obstacle avoidance, auto-landing, and soft crash sensors prevent injuries and damage.
- Ease of Use: Simplified controls and beginner modes make flying accessible to children of all ages.
- Durability: Rugged construction ensures the drones withstand rough handling and minor crashes.
- Camera and Connectivity: Some models include cameras for aerial photography and are compatible with mobile apps for easy control.

Safety Tips for Flying Kid Drones in 2026
Despite advanced safety features, responsible flying is essential. Here are some tips for children and parents:
- Always fly in open areas away from crowds and wildlife.
- Follow the manufacturer’s instructions and safety guidelines.
- Keep the drone within visual line of sight at all times.
- Avoid flying near airports, busy roads, or restricted airspace.
- Supervise young children during flight to ensure safe operation.
